Rapper Fatman Scoop Dead At 53 After Collapsing On Stage

Rapper Fatman Scoop, born with the name Isaac Freeman III, has died. He was 53.

His family and tour manager, Birch Michael, shared statements on social media following the artist’s death. His official cause of death has not been revealed.

“It is with profound sadness and very heavy hearts that we share news of the passing of the legendary and iconic FatMan Scoop,” a post on his Instagram page read on behalf of his family. “Last night, the world lost a radiant soul, a beacon of light on the stage and in life.”

The hype man and radio personality was performing at a summer concert, Friday, hosted at Hamden Town Center Park in Connecticut. Hamden is six miles from New Haven.

Mayor Lauren Garrett shared on Facebook that the rapper had a “medical emergency on stage” and was transported to the hospital by ambulance.

Video circulated online of the rapper shirtless and hyping up the crowd shortly before he collapsed. A loud thud was heard in the background.

“Hold up, you gotta understand this. Big man, gotta relax, I’m stretching… Big man gotta chill,” a voice over the mic said out of breath. “They ain’t got no fans on this stage. Jesus.”

Medical staff were seen running towards the stage and appeared to be performing CPR on the rapper.
